Enter a world where animals speak and simple truths of life are shared through captivating stories in the Illustrated Edition of Aesop’s Fables. This collection compiles the wisdom and life lessons from Aesop, believed to have lived around 600 BC in ancient Greece. These fables resonate with readers of all ages, sharing lessons on honesty, justice, prudence, and compassion through stories that entertain and enlighten.
